Plant-Based Meal Plan
This week, the meal plan will focus on simple, whole foods. I’ll do my best to keep it simple. When we have leftovers, I’ll skip cooking.
Monday
Baked Potato
Bean and Rice Bowl
Tuesday
Breakfast Hash (using leftover baked potatoes, rice, beans, and veggies)
“Beefy” Lentil and Veggie Soup
Wednesday
Leftovers
Thursday
Fruit and Granola
Leftovers
Unfried Black Beans (oil-free), Cilantro-Lime Quinoa (or rice) and avocado
Friday
Instant Pot Oatmeal (using fresh blueberries)
Lentils, Broccoli Mashed Potatoes, and Carrots
